YORK HOUSE centre MIXED YOUTH CLUB is now on WEDNESDAYS!

Wed 10 Jul 2024


York House Centre runs a mixed youth club for young people age 7-14 years every Wednesday evening during term-time from 5.30-7.30pm. It is open access to all young people so why don’t you give it a try?

Activities include Sports, games, arts & crafts, pool table, table football, cooking, projects and much more! The club makes great use of our outside spaces, particularly the AstroTurf sports pitch. Enjoy meeting up with friends and making new ones in a fun, relaxed environment.

Mixed Youth Club

Ages: 7-14 years

Time: 5.30pm – 7.30pm

Cost: £1 per session.

Refreshments provided.

Sign up using the QR code on the attached Youth club blurb or go to www.ynmk.org.uk and click on ‘Join us’ to complete an enrolment form. Once you press ‘submit’ you can turn up at the club.

The club is funded in partnership with Stony Stratford Town Council and delivered by Youth Network which is a part of Bletchley Youth centre charity.

 New Senior Youth Café?

During the pandemic we lost the Senior Youth Club but would love to get it up and running again – maybe as a Youth Café for young people to get together on a weekly basis, socialise and plan some trips out. Let us know if you are interested in helping us to get this going.
